Refreshed Millers seeking home comforts

Redditch Editorial 26th Jan, 2017   0

FECKENHAM assistant manager Tom Davies is hoping the postponement of last weekend’s game will enable several Millers players to shake off niggling injuries in time to face Hampton at the Entaco on Saturday (2pm).

A frozen pitch put paid to Saturday’s scheduled visit of Smithswood Firs and Davies and Co will now hope for better luck with the weather this weekend.

“It was a shame we couldn’t get the game on against Smithswood Firs as we all felt we had something to go out and prove after our last performance against Coton Green.

“We had a good talk with the squad after the result and had a fantastic response off them at training on Tuesday evening. That said, we’ve got a couple with ‘niggly’ injuries and a week off with the non-stop season we’ve had may be a blessing in disguise.”




Meanwhile, the Millers management have continued with their policy of giving a chance to young potential to impress in Midland League Division Two.

Davies is also coach of Alvechurch U18s, whilst Feckenham manager Aaron Blackwood is joint youth team manager of Highgate United U18s.


Davies explained: “Although we’re happy with the squad that’s been assembled, we never stop in looking to recruit, especially when it comes to the quality youth players Aaron and I both work with.

“Adam Garmson has been in fantastic form for both sides and, having recently added Reece Edwards-Williams and Sid Hicks from Alvechurch, we are delighted to announce we are set to bring in Will Langston and Logan Madden, a defender and midfielder respectively, from Highgate United’s youth ranks.

“Aaron speaks highly of the pair and has had a very positive conversation with Ashley Pulisciano (Highgate United first team manager) who has agreed Feckenham is the right club for these boys to continue their development.”

This will take the number of youth team players used in the Feckenham first team this season to six, with goalkeeper Tristan Roberts having been involved with the squad earlier in the season.

REDDITCH Borough resume their Midland League Division Two campaign against Earlswood Town at the Trico Stadium on Saturday (3pm).

Seventh placed Borough were beaten 3-0 at Wednesfield in the Birmingham Saturday Vase quarter-finals on Saturday.
